  1. Darren Aronofsky (born February 12, 1969) is an American filmmaker. His films are noted for their surreal, melodramatic, and often disturbing elements, frequently in the form of psychological fiction .

    • The Wrestler. According to Aronofsky, he began developing "The Wrestler" and "Black Swan" in tandem before splitting them into separate projects. With that in mind, it's easy to spot the similarities between Mickey Rourke's Randy "The Ram" Robinson and Natalie Portman's Nina Sayers: Both push their bodies to dangerous lengths in order to reach the pinnacle of success in their chosen fields.
